The work spectrum of an HAW professorship is very diverse. Teaching, research and organization are the largest components. These include
Teaching
- Giving lectures, practical courses and seminars
- Preparing and supervising examinations
- Supervising theses
- Being the contact person for students (regarding course work and assessed work, module assignments, internship recommendations, etc.)
- Accompanying projects and excursions (also in cooperation with companies)
Research
- Ensure networking with other academics
- Giving lectures at congresses, conferences, etc.
- Supervise doctoral candidates if necessary
- Acquire third-party funding
- Publications in journals and at conferences
- Writing expert opinions
Academic self-administration
- Tasks in the university administration
- Possibly taking over the management of a degree program, Dean's Office, etc.
- Supervision of the team (doctoral candidates, research assistants)
The HAW professorship and the professorship at a university differ in some respects. The biggest difference is that the focus of studies and research at a HAW is more on application than at a university. For this reason, previous work outside the university is a prerequisite (at least 3 years). The tasks are similar, but the number of teaching hours per week is higher at an HAW (16 SWS).

Active recruitment at universities of applied sciences - a profitability analysis
In light of the impending generational shift at universities of applied sciences and the growing challenges in faculty recruitment, the tool of active recruitment is gaining increasing strategic importance. This paper uses experiences from the joint project CASE to analyze the extent to which investments in active recruitment strategies are economically worthwhile particularly under conditions of limited resources. At the core is a cost-effectiveness analysis, which shows that, under the stated assumptions, active recruitment already pays off if only 17% of the procedures prevent the need for a repeated call for applications. It thus proves to be a strategically valuable instrument for attracting academic staff. This study offers a practice-oriented contribution to the further development of modern recruitment strategies at public universities and highlights the potential for their institutional consolidation.

Doing a doctorate at HAWs in Saxony-Anhalt
In Saxony-Anhalt, universities of applied sciences can independently award doctoral degrees to their doctoral students. You can find an overview of the topic here.
